Y423 LDP is a 2001 Iveco Daily in White with a 2,798c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 22 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 63.6%.

Across all 2001 Iveco Daily models, the average MOT pass rate is 62.2% with a typical mileage of 117,890 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Iveco Daily f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 54,319 recorded failures. If you're considering buying Y423 LDP,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Iveco Daily typ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 25 years old, this Iveco Daily is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
